The Handbook for the Military Surgeon by Charles S. Tripler is a comprehensive guidebook that outlines the duties of medical officers in the field during times of war. The book provides a detailed compendium on war surgery, covering topics such as the management of wounds, fractures, and injuries sustained in battle. It also includes information on the proper use of medical equipment, such as bandages, splints, and surgical instruments.The book is organized into several sections, each of which covers a different aspect of military medicine. The first section provides an overview of the role of the medical officer in the field, including their responsibilities for the care of soldiers and the management of medical supplies. The second section focuses on the treatment of injuries sustained in battle, including gunshot wounds, amputations, and other traumatic injuries.The third section of the book covers the use of anesthesia and surgical techniques, including the use of chloroform and ether as anesthetics, and the proper technique for performing surgical procedures in the field. The fourth section provides a detailed description of the various types of medical equipment and supplies that are necessary for the care of soldiers in the field.Throughout the book, Tripler emphasizes the importance of proper hygiene and sanitation in preventing the spread of disease and infection among soldiers. He also provides detailed instructions on the care and transport of wounded soldiers, including the use of ambulances and field hospitals.Overall, the Handbook for the Military Surgeon is a valuable resource for medical officers and other healthcare professionals working in the field during times of war.
